Re: Cleaning and coating tires (Tac System tire coat)
I`ve found that Tufshine lasts 2 months.
Glen`s experience with the Tac System shows it lasting 3 months for him.
The feedback for McKee`s 37 shows it lasts an amazing 11 months.
We might have a Winner.

So tried “topping” with some PERL 2-1 after a month to see what would happen. Used foam applicator. Usually PERL wipes in smooth but in this case the tire kinda rejected it and it beaded up. Used a cheap MF to smooth out.
https://uploads.tapatalk-cdn.com/201...99a01bbf73.jpg
https://uploads.tapatalk-cdn.com/201...fb04bdecb1.jpg
Here you can see run off marks after a rain. Coating is holding up and trying to “clean” off the PERL.

Re: Cleaning and coating tires (Tac System tire coat)
Depending on the look you like i would say in spring weather you could get 1.5 months out of it with a matt look. 3 weeks if you want a little glossier. Not that much harder to apply to tires and i did a decent cleaning job. Im looking for 2 months plus.
